Among the most reputable techniques for long term defense includes the setup of chemical soil barriers. This strategy requires the application of specialized termiticides into the ground surrounding the foundations of the structure. The objective is to create a continuous zone of cured soil that either wards off the bugs or removes them upon contact. In numerous regional suburbs where homes are built on concrete slabs or have actually suspended wood floors this barrier functions as a frontline defence. It is a robust technique that offers peace of mind for several years supplied that the treated zone stays undisturbed by subsequent landscaping or restorations.
Lots of Canberra residents pick to utilize baiting and monitoring systems as a key element of their Termite Treatment strategy. This approach is especially important in locations with unique factors to consider or obstacles, such as paved website surfaces or detailed building styles that make standard soil barriers impractical. Bait stations are tactically positioned around the residential or commercial property to obstruct foraging termites. Upon discovering activity, a slow-acting bait is presented, which the termites carry back to the main nest. Eventually, this process causes the whole termite colony to collapse, an outcome that can not be achieved by just targeting individual bugs. It is an extremely effective technique for managing termite populations without relying on substantial chemical treatments.
Routine upkeep and yearly inspections stay the cornerstone of any successful pest management method in Australia. Even with a treatment plan in place the altering seasons and shifting soil conditions can affect the effectiveness of a barrier. Professionals in the field advise that property owners keep an eye on wetness levels around the base of their homes as moist soil is a major attractant for these pests. Making sure that gardens are kept away from the walls which ventilation under the floor is clear can significantly minimize the threat of a new invasion taking hold.
